Compounding sea level rise and climate variability accelerate extreme sea level hazards in western tropical Pacific islands

摘要
The western tropical Pacific (WTP) is a global hotspot for sea-level rise (SLR) and intense climatic extremes, rendering low-lying islands acutely vulnerable to catastrophic extreme sea levels (ESLs) and inundation. However, the relative contributions and joint modulation of multi-scale drivers for ESLs remain poorly constrained, limiting our ability to assess future risk probabilities in this region. Here we show that a distinct spatial contrast in ESL forcing emerges in the WTP: while tides and weather extremes dominate in marginal seas, interannual-to-decadal sea-level variability governs the low-frequency modulation of ESL occurrences across WTP islands. Under compound conditions of strong La Niña and high tides, an SLR of merely 13–20 cm is likely (>83% probability) to trigger ESL events exceeding the 99.5th percentile for WTP islands. Furthermore, while El Niño has historically buffered islands against ESLs by suppressing local sea levels, a 39–50 cm SLR would lead to a high probability (>83%) of ESL occurrence under high tides even during strong El Niño phases, effectively negating this climatic buffering effect. With observed SLR already approaching 10 cm at several island stations, our findings indicate that WTP islands are entering a regime of rapidly escalating inundation risk, driven by the synergistic interaction between persistent SLR and natural climate variability.
